TAGLIATELLE WITH BABY VEGETABLES AND LEMON-PARMESAN SAUCE
The pasta cooking liquid helps turn the cheese, cream, and sautéed vegetables into an incredible sauce.

Steps:
- Cook pasta in large pot of boiling salted water until just tender. Drain, reserving 2 cups cooking liquid. Return pasta to pot.
- Meanwhile, heat oil in large skillet over medium heat. Add onion and zucchini; sprinkle with salt and pepper. Sauté until zucchini is almost tender, about 8 minutes. Add beans and lemon peel. Toss 1 minute.
- Scrape contents of skillet over pasta in pot. Add 1 1/4 cups Parmesan cheese, cream, lemon juice, and 1 cup reserved cooking liquid. Place over medium-high heat and toss until heated through and sauce coats pasta, adding more reserved pasta liquid by 1/4 cupfuls to moisten as needed.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Serve, passing additional cheese separately.
PASTA PRIMAVERA
This fresh, delicious Pasta Primavera dish is loaded with roasted vegetables like summer squash, broccoli, juicy ripe tomatoes, lemon, basil and Parmesan cheese flavors.

Steps:
- Cook pasta in salted boiling water according to the instructions on the box and make sure to save some of the cooking water for the sauce. Drain pasta and set aside.
- Preheat oven to 425° and place a sheet of parchment paper on a baking sheet.
- Chop vegetables and place all vegetables except onion, garlic, and tomatoes into a mixing bowl. (You will use onion and garlic in the sauce and stir tomatoes into the pasta at the end.)
- Toss vegetables with olive oil, lemon juice, dried parsley, salt, and pepper until evenly seasoned.
- Spread vegetables in one even layer on a parchment paper covered baking sheet and bake for 10-15 minutes, depending on how soft you want them.
- Preheat a large pot of a large Dutch oven, and melt butter in it. Add sliced onion and sauté until golden brown.
- Add pressed garlic, stir in with onions, and sauté until fragrant and starts to brown as well.
- Mix cooking water from pasta, chicken stock, and lemon juice in and pour it into the pot. Let it simmer for a few minutes.
- Stir in grated Parmesan cheese and some salt and pepper and let it cook for a few seconds, until cheese starts to melt and incorporate into the sauce.
- Stir in cooked pasta, vegetables, chopped tomatoes, minced basil, and lemon zest. Let it cook for just a couple more minutes as you mix everything together and serve!

LEMON RICOTTA PASTA WITH VEGETABLES
This is my "kitchen sink" pasta dish, you can use whatever veggies or cheeses you have on hand. The combo sounds a little odd but you'll be surprised of the amount of flavor you get!

Steps:
-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add penne and cook, stirring occasionally, until tender yet firm to the bite, about 11 minutes.
- Meanwhile, melt but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add mushrooms, onion, bell pepper, and garlic; saute until softened, 5 to 10 minutes. Season with salt, pepper, 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ning, and crushed red chili pepper. Add spinach and tomato towards the end of the saute process and cook until spinach has wilted.
- Season ricotta cheese with more Italian seasoning, garlic powder, and onion powder. Stir seasoned ricotta cheese into the vegetable mixture with Parmesan cheese, lemon zest, and lemon juice. Heat over medium-high heat until heated all the way through, 3 to 5 minutes.
- Plate and top with mozzarella.

LEMONY VEGETABLES AND PASTA
My refreshing pasta dish comes together in 30 minutes. Its simplicity and flavor combinations are typical of authentic Italian cuisine. Buon appetito! -Erin Mylroie, Santa Clara, Utah

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the asparagus, red pepper, onion, oil, salt and pepper. Transfer to a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an. Bake at 450° for 10-15 minutes or until golden brown, stirring once., Meanwhile, cook pasta according to package directions. In a large sa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Stir in the flour, garlic and pepper flakes until blended. Whisk in broth until blended.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ened and bubbly. , Reduce heat. Stir in the cheese, sour cream, lemon juice and zest; heat through. Drain pasta and place in a large bowl. Add cheese sauce and asparagus mixture; toss to coat. Sprinkle with pistachios, basil and additional cheese.
